Just a thought about exclamation points and helping others

As I surf through the wild, colorful and “promising” ads across the web, I can’t help but wonder…

Why all the hype and exclamation points?
Is this really what it takes to get someone to click on your link?

Don’t get me wrong. I’m not saying all advertising is hype. I know better than that… and you do too.

But I think there’s a better way to get folks to know you’reĀ  sincere about helping them succeed without resorting to hackneyed phrases like, “I can’t succeed unless I help you succeed.”

I wonder if what they’re really saying is, “I wouldn’t be helping you, buddy, if there wasn’t anything in it for me.”

That better way is to be honest in your desire and willingness to help people — whether you think they’re going to return the favor or not.

Is that a part of your business plan…or not?
